Как обратиться к ячейке Excel в Python? 📊🐍
В Python вы можете обратиться к ячейке Excel, используя библиотеку openpyxl. Вот пример:
import openpyxl
# Открываем файл Excel
workbook = openpyxl.load_workbook('имя_файла.xlsx')
# Выбираем нужный лист
sheet = workbook['имя_листа']
# Обращаемся к ячейке
value = sheet['A1'].value
# Выводим значение ячейки
print(value)
Детальный ответ
Как обратиться к ячейке Excel в Python
В этой статье мы рассмотрим, как обратиться к ячейке Excel при использовании языка программирования Python. Будут представлены примеры кода, которые помогут вам понять основные концепции и выполнить соответствующие операции.
Шаг 1: Установка библиотеки Openpyxl
Прежде чем начать, убедитесь, что у вас установлена библиотека Openpyxl. Она предоставляет удобные инструменты для работы с файлами Excel в формате .xlsx.
pip install openpyxl
Шаг 2: Импортирование необходимых модулей
Вам понадобится импортировать модуль openpyxl, чтобы использовать его функциональность для работы с Excel файлами.
import openpyxl
Шаг 3: Открытие файла Excel
Чтобы обратиться к ячейке в Excel файле, вам сначала нужно открыть его с помощью библиотеки Openpyxl. Укажите путь к файлу в функции open()
.
workbook = openpyxl.load_workbook('file.xlsx')
Шаг 4: Выбор активного листа
После открытия файла вы можете выбрать активный лист, с которым будет происходить работа.
sheet = workbook.active
Шаг 5: Получение значения ячейки
Для получения значения конкретной ячейки вам необходимо использовать координаты строки и столбца. В Python индексация начинается с 1.
cell_value = sheet.cell(row=1, column=1).value
print(cell_value)
Шаг 6: Установка значения ячейки
Если вы хотите установить значение для определенной ячейки, проверьте, что активный лист выбран, а затем используйте следующий код:
sheet.cell(row=1, column=1).value = "Новое значение"
workbook.save('file.xlsx')
Шаг 7: Закрытие файла
После завершения работы с файлом, не забудьте закрыть его, чтобы освободить ресурсы.
workbook.close()
Заключение
В этой статье мы изучили, как обратиться к ячейке Excel в Python. Мы рассмотрели основные шаги, которые помогут вам начать работу с файлами Excel и выполнять различные операции, такие как получение и установка значений ячеек. Не забывайте закрывать файл после использования.